A Modern New Build in a Quiet Hyogo Neighborhood
This newly constructed detached house in Kakogawa City, Hyogo Prefecture, offers a spacious and well-equipped living environment. The property features a 4SLDK layout, providing four bedrooms, a living, dining, and kitchen area, plus an additional service room. The total floor area is 103.29 sqm (approximately 31.24 tsubo), situated on a land plot of 149.73 sqm (about 45.29 tsubo). The two-story wooden structure is scheduled for completion in November 2025.
The property is comprehensively equipped with city gas, water supply, sewerage, and electricity. Notable amenities include two toilets with warm-water washlet functions, a bath larger than 1 tsubo with a reheating function and a shampoo dresser, a system kitchen with a water purifier, double-glazed windows, a 24-hour ventilation system, a garden, underfloor storage, a walk-in closet, and a video monitor intercom. Special notes highlight barrier-free design features, its location in a quiet residential area, and parking space for two vehicles.
The road access details specify a 6-meter wide public road to the north, with no positional designation required. The land is designated for Category 1 Low-Rise Exclusive Residential use within the urbanization promotion area.
